Aims & Scope

Welding Technology Review (abbreviation Weld. Tech. Rev.) is an open access, peer-reviewed journal published bimonthly by the Society of Polish Mechanical Engineers and Technicians since 1928. The scope covers a wide range of Mechanical Engineering and Materials Science topics related to joining processes. The journal accepts regular scientific papers (original research articles and review papers) related to research and technology development of the broadly understood joining engineering. We welcome both experimental and theoretical papers on all aspects of materials joining, including welding, brazing, soldering, surfacing, thermal cutting and testing of the joints of advanced structure or functional materials.

Welding Technology Review articles are published open access under a CC BY licence (Creative Commons Attribution 4.0 International licence). The CC BY licence is the most open licence available and considered the industry 'gold standard' for open access; it is also preferred by many funders. This licence allows readers to copy and redistribute the material in any medium or format, and to alter, transform, or build upon the material, including for commercial use, providing the original author is credited.
